Princess Grace of Monaco
In 1982, Princess Grace lost control of the vehicle in which she and her daughter were travelling. While Princess Stephanie survived the accident with minor injuries, Kelly lingered in a coma for barely 24 hours, before she died on 14 September having never regained consciousness. It was later determined that the Princess had suffered a stroke which had led to the crash.
Princess Grace was given a full royal funeral at the Cathedral of St Nicholas in Monte Carlo. - The Biography Channel BBC
